Marlow FM success at radio awards

| |

Two presenters from Marlow FM have received accolades at the Community Radio Awards 2020. Gemma-Leigh James won silver in the female presenter category, and Amelia Slaughter also won silver for her entertainment show.  Many congratulations to both!!

The awards ceremony took place online on Saturday 12 December. 

Gemma-Leigh presents ‘Breakfast’ on Thursdays and ‘Afternoon Gold 90s’. Amelia’s ‘She Said What?’ programme, with its mix of music and showbiz gossip, goes out every Saturday at midday. 

Gemma-Leigh said: “I’m over the moon to have won silver again this year, and I can’t wait to do so much more next year. But this award is really for the team – a lot of work went on behind the scenes to keep us all safe and broadcasting.” 

Amelia said: “It’s been such a horrible year for everyone, and to be able to bring some fun to everyone’s day via the radio has been a real joy. All the presenters at Marlow FM have been working so hard throughout the pandemic to keep our listeners informed and the community connected, so it’s really lovely for us to receive some recognition.” 

Two other presenters had also been shortlisted for an award: Lucy Ashburner for young person of the year, and Angie Burns for newcomer of the year. 

More than 460 entries from 90 radio stations were whittled down to five per category.
